Output 385e54ab1391df142117668e494b98069ed303272f28fbb20f36a13119a9e45e:19

value
1100356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95ab12cee961c561fc855c7f247cd006e1785668 OP_EQUALVERIFY OP_CHECKSIG
address
1EeNcybZaTyYbVFX7CRDYasv8bpTVfr2Bj
transaction
385e54ab1391df142117668e494b98069ed303272f28fbb20f36a13119a9e45e
spent
true